Critical 2026 topics, fully covered

AI-powered attacks

From ChatGPT-generated phishing emails to AI voice cloning, employees learn to spot synthetic content and question what seems too perfect.

CEO fraud and deepfakes

We simulate realistic deepfake scenarios so your team knows what to look for when that “urgent” video message from leadership appears.

Advanced phishing

Gone are the days of obvious spelling errors. Modern phishing is personalized, contextual, and convincing. We train people to pause and verify, every time.

Psychology and manipulation

Understanding how social engineering exploits human nature. Trust, urgency, authority. When you know the playbook, you can defend against it.

Resilience and response

It’s not just about prevention. It’s about knowing what to do when something feels wrong. Building a culture where people speak up without fear.
